  • Publication number: 20210406995
    Abstract: In the creative community, a need exists to efficiently market creative works including music, concerts, photographic, video programs, motion pictures, two and three dimensional works of art and literary works. The cost of creating works of art has never been less. Computer programs like Garage Band and iMovie have lowered production costs so that more people than ever before are engaged in creativity. The present invention links the creative community with investors, venue owners, social media influencers, other artists, art critics, art distributors, literary agents, art brokers and dealers and the overall audience for creative works. The present invention represents a significant augmentation to the traditional artists and repertoire departments of the major record companies and will enable a bidding marketplace so that creative works may be monetized at the moment of creation and combined with other preexisting artwork to enable marketing compilations or derivative works expeditiously.
    Type: Application
    Filed: May 17, 2021
    Publication date: December 30, 2021
    Inventors: SKYE PETERS, JOHN W. OLIVO, Jr.
